Xgal staining
Frozen Section Xgal Stain
1. Cut unfixed frozen sections. Air-drying is not harmful to Bgal activity.
2. Fix 0.5% Glutaraldehyde in PBS for 1 minute. PFA fixation kills enzyme activity.
3. Wash with PBS 10 minutes.
4. Place slides in humidified chamber
5. Add Xgal solution (premade as per wholemount protocol), important that pH is not lower than 7.5 or endogenous Bgal activity will be high.
Xgal Solution:
5mM K3Fe(CN)6,
5mM K4Fe(CN)6,
2mM MgCl2,
0.01% Na deoxycholate,
0.02% NP-40,
1mg/ml Xgal,
Make up at least 24 hrs before, decant before using to avoid crystals on sections.
6. Incubate at 37 degrees for several hours, or overnight at RT or 4 degrees
7. Monitor, stop by washing in PBS
8. Counter stain 1-2 minutes nuclear fast red, Eosin works well too.
9. Wash ddH20 several times, then mount in crystalmount and then permount.
